Data Processing Notes:
----------------------
Conductivity, Transmissivity and Fluorescence are nominal and unedited except
that some records were removed in editing temperature and salinity.
The SBE DO sensor calibration changed during a previous use in 2022. No
change was noted during this cruise, though the correction (based on comparison
with titrated samples) is larger than normally seen for this type of sensor.
The SBE DO sensor has a fairly long response time so data accuracy is not as high
when it is in motion as it is during stops for bottles. This will be especially true
when vertical DO gradients are large. To get an estimate of the accuracy of the
SBE DO data during downcasts (after recalibration) a rough comparison was made between
downcast SBE DO and upcast titrated samples. Much of the difference will be due to
problems with flushing of Niskin bottles and/or analysis errors, so the following
statement likely underestimates SBE DO accuracy.
Downcast (CTD files) Oxygen:Dissolved:SBE data for this cruise are considered, very
roughly, to be:
±0.25 mL/L from 0-100db except in areas of very large DO gradients
±0.07 mL/L from 100db-150db
±0.02 mL/L below 150db
